Sanshin Sushi
Three Hearts Sushi 'Sanshin' means 'three hearts', which reflects the exact number of people behind the sushi counter, Piyasith Punin, his brother, and girl-friend. These three people have undertaken the interior design of this sushi bar, featuring gentle shades and hues, light wood and glass. You can sit by the huge windows, offering prime views of street life, or in the open kitchen where all precision-cuts are made. Dining space is limited, but you can manage to squeeze in. Many customers avail themselves of Sanshin's take-away service. Sushi Menu The menu features all the traditional favourites such as maki rolls, nigiri, and sashimi. In addition to these, Sanshin serves up excellent gourmet nigiris with foie gras or oysters, and delicious inside-out rolls sporting names such as 'Rainbow' or 'San Frankie'. Sanshin also has vegetarian and meat dishes on the menu, ensuring that all palates are catered for.
